
How to Choose the Best Web Development for Ecommerce: A Complete Guide
Choosing the right web development for ecommerce can make or break your online business. A well-developed ecommerce website attracts customers, improves conversions, builds trust, and supports your long-term growth. With so many options in the market, selecting the best service provider becomes confusing.
This complete guide will help you choose the perfect ecommerce web development company by breaking everything down into clear points.
1. Understand Your Ecommerce Business Needs
Before hiring any developer or agency, clearly define what you need.
Key Points to Consider
-
Type of Products You Sell
Digital products, physical items, subscriptions, or custom-made products require different development setups. -
Expected Website Size
Small catalog? Large catalog with thousands of SKUs? This impacts the platform choice and database setup. -
Target Audience & Market
Local, national, or international customers? Multi-currency and multi-language support might be required. -
Business Model
B2C, B2B, Dropshipping, Wholesale, Marketplace, Print-on-Demand, etc. -
Required Features
- Advanced product filters
- Real-time inventory management
- Vendor dashboards
- Order tracking
- Membership levels
- Dynamic pricing
-
Your Budget & Timeline
Helps narrow down the level of expertise needed.
2. Compare Ecommerce Platforms
Below is a table comparing major ecommerce platforms:
Ecommerce Platform Comparison Table
| Platform | Best For | Pros | Cons | Cost Level |
|---|---|---|---|---|
| Shopify | Startups & fast launch | Easy to use, secure, 24/7 support | Limited customization | Medium |
| WooCommerce | Custom & SEO-friendly stores | Full customization, low cost | Requires maintenance | Low–Medium |
| Magento | Large enterprise stores | Highly scalable, powerful | Expensive development | High |
| Shopify Plus | High-volume stores | Enterprise-level tools, fast | Expensive monthly fees | Very High |
| Custom Development | Unique or complex businesses | Unlimited flexibility | Higher development time | High |
3. Check the Developer’s Experience in Ecommerce
The right team should have proven experience specifically in web development for ecommerce, not just general website development.
What to Evaluate
-
Portfolio of ecommerce projects
Check their past work for design quality, speed, and functionality. -
Industry knowledge
Experience in your niche (fashion, electronics, beauty, food delivery, B2B tools, etc.). -
Knowledge of ecommerce integrations
- Payment gateways
- CRM tools
- ERP systems
- Inventory management
- Shipping & logistics APIs
-
Understanding of ecommerce UX/UI trends
Modern, fast, mobile-friendly design.
4. Evaluate Their Technical Skills
A web development company should be strong in the technical aspects that matter for ecommerce.
Essential Technical Skills
- Frontend: HTML5, CSS3, JavaScript, React, Vue
- Backend: PHP, Node.js, Laravel, Python
- Database: MySQL, MongoDB
- CMS Expertise: Shopify, WooCommerce, Magento
- Integrations: Payment, shipping, accounting tools
- Security Knowledge: SSL, PCI compliance, encryption
- Speed Optimization Skills: Lazy loading, CDN setup, caching
5. Check Their Understanding of Ecommerce SEO
Good development supports SEO from day one.
SEO Factors to Examine
- Clean URL structure
- Fast loading speed
- Mobile responsiveness
- Schema markup
- XML sitemap setup
- Category & product SEO optimization
- SEO-friendly code and design
- Integration with Google Analytics & Search Console
Without SEO-focused development, your ecommerce website won’t rank—even if it looks good.
6. Ask About Security and Compliance
Security is non-negotiable for ecommerce.
Security Essentials
- SSL implementation
- Secure checkout
- Data encryption
- PCI DSS compliance
- Anti-hacking measures (firewalls, malware scans)
- Secure customer data storage
- Regular security updates
7. Evaluate Website Speed & Performance Optimization
Fast websites convert more.
Important Speed Factors
- Optimized images
- Lightweight code
- CDN integration
- Fast hosting
- Caching
- Minified CSS/JS
- Database optimization
Ask the developer how they plan to ensure loading times under 2–3 seconds.
8. Ask About Scalability
Your ecommerce website should grow with your business.
Scalability Features
- Ability to add new categories
- Support for bulk product uploads
- Higher server capacity
- Scalable databases
- Flexible architecture for future upgrades
9. Clear Pricing and Transparent Costs
Understand the full cost before starting.
Important Cost Points
- Development charges
- Theme or UI design cost
- Plugin/extension fees
- Hosting expenses
- Maintenance cost
- Custom feature development cost
- Third-party integrations
Choose companies that offer clear pricing with no hidden fees.
10. Strong Post-Launch Support
Ecommerce needs ongoing support.
Look for:
- Bug fixing
- Backup management
- Security monitoring
- Plugin/theme updates
- Emergency support
- Monthly or yearly maintenance options
A good development partner helps you even after the website goes live.
11. Check Reviews, Ratings, and Client Feedback
Customer experiences reveal real quality.
Where to Check
- Google reviews
- Clutch
- Trustpilot
- Website testimonials
- Case studies
Choose teams with real, verifiable feedback.
12. Request a Demo or Strategy Session
A professional company will:
- Discuss your goals
- Suggest the ideal platform
- Recommend essential features
- Provide a roadmap and timeline
- Show sample designs
This helps you judge their expertise and communication style.
13. Choose a Team That Understands Marketing + Development
Ecommerce success depends not just on a website but also on conversions.
Look for Marketing-Driven Development
- Conversion-focused design
- Optimized product pages
- Clear CTAs
- A/B testing support
- Upsell & cross-sell features
- Cart abandonment solutions
Developers with marketing knowledge deliver far better results.
Conclusion
Choosing the best web development for ecommerce is a strategic decision that directly impacts your business growth. By focusing on experience, platform expertise, SEO knowledge, security, scalability, and post-launch support, you can confidently select the right partner.
A well-developed ecommerce website is not just a digital shop—it’s the engine that powers your online success.
Daksha Design is available 24/7 365 days a year. © 2026 All Rights Reserved
Post Comment
Fields marked with an asterisk (*) must be filled out before submitting.